The Itinerary Breakdown: What to Expect

Pickup and Arrival at Hathi Gaon
The tour begins with a Tuk Tuk pickup from your Jaipur hotel or preferred location, making the experience smooth and stress-free. The journey to Hathi Gaon takes around 30-45 minutes, giving you a glimpse of Rajasthan’s countryside and a moment to get excited about what’s ahead. Upon arrival, you’ll be greeted by friendly mahouts and elephants who are accustomed to interacting with visitors.
Introduction and Orientation
Your guide will introduce you to the elephants and their caretakers, sharing insights into their daily routines and the challenges faced by elephants in India. This is a perfect chance to ask questions about elephant care, conservation efforts, or cultural significance.
More Great Tours NearbyChoose Your Experience
You’ll then select your preferred activity:
- Feeding: Hand-feed elephants sugarcane, bananas, or other treats. It’s a gentle, tactile experience that fosters connection. Reviewers mention that the mahouts are happy to share tips on the best ways to feed and interact with these creatures.
- Riding (Safari): Hop onto a traditional howdah or seat and enjoy a gentle ride through the village, offering a different perspective of the surroundings. While not a safari in the wild, it’s a charming way to see the countryside from above.
- Painting: Unleash your artistic side by painting on the elephant’s skin with safe, natural colors. This activity is both fun and memorable, especially for families or groups who love creative moments.
Learning and Photos
Throughout your activity, expect the mahouts and guides to share stories about elephants’ roles in Indian culture, their care routines, and conservation. As the tour winds down, you’ll have plenty of opportunities for photos—especially at the iconic Jal Mahal, visible from the village—making for beautiful souvenirs.
Return Journey
After your chosen activity, your private vehicle will take you back to Jaipur, ending a 1-2 hour journey filled with authentic interactions and meaningful memories.

Transportation, Timing, and Practical Details
The tour provides Tuk Tuk pickup and drop-off, simplifying logistics and eliminating the need to navigate public transport. The duration is flexible, generally lasting between 1 to 2 hours, making it suitable for travelers with tight schedules or those wanting a quick, impactful experience.
Pricing is generally reasonable considering the private nature of the tour, including transportation, guide, and activities. It offers excellent value, especially given the chance for hands-on interaction. The tour is wheelchair accessible and suitable for private groups, making it inclusive for different travelers.
The availability varies, so it’s wise to check ahead and book in advance. Cancellation is flexible too—up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und—giving peace of mind to those with changing plans.
